[0063] The present invention will be further described below in conjunction with examples, but the protection scope of the present invention is not limited to this:

[0064] Take a composting plant as an example. The raw materials for composting are animal manure and tail vegetables. A camera and a thermal imager are installed on the top of the fermenter to monitor a production cycle of the fermenter. The data collection interval is set to 2 hours. A total of 1500 thermal imaging images and compost surface are collected. Article data. There are 300 test samples and 1200 training samples.

[0065] Combine figure 1 , A method for judging the maturity of non-contact canned compost, including the following steps:

[0066] S1. Extract image data at time t, including 255×3 dimensional thermal image color histogram data and compost surface RGB image data.

Abstract

The invention discloses a noncontact canned compost maturity determining method comprising the following steps: S1, extracting image data at time t; S2, preprocessing; S3, based on data obtained in S2, constructing a convolutional neural network (CNN) for extracting the feature of a compost image to obtains a 255-dimensional feature vector; S4, combining the color histogram data of an thermal image in the S1 with the feature vector output by the image feature extraction CNN in the S3 to form a real-time compost feature, and normalizing the real-time compost feature; S5 performing prediction based on a long short term memory (LSTM) network; and S6, outputting a determined result. The method for real-time detection of compost state based on temperature and appearance is accurate in results and easy to operate.

Description

Technical field [0001] The invention uses the natural image information of the compost pile and the thermal imaging image taken by the thermal imager to perform feature extraction and then classification through a deep learning neural network to determine the maturity of the compost in real time, and belongs to the field of agricultural informatics. Background technique [0002] The maturity of fertilizers is extremely important for the growth of crops. The use of immature fertilizers will not only not have a positive effect on the growth of crops, but will also attract flies and worms to lay eggs and corrode the roots of crops. The proliferation of microorganisms will also cause soil hypoxia. . The fully decomposed fertilizer will not cause adverse effects on the environment and is convenient for transportation, which is beneficial to improve soil fertility and promote plant growth.
